Hello @frenzy1212,
unfortunately there seems to be a limitation as to which objects can be pickled in windows. Since I have no way to reproduce this error I can show you a workaround.
You can set the distribution
-parameter to "joblib"
in the Hyperactive
-class. My joblib implementation does not include the setting of the lock of tqdm (because joblib does not have an initializer argument).
However you will probably experience the progress-bars jumping around in the command line when using multiple jobs (with joblib). This is what the tqdm-lock solves (for multiprocessing).
